Injured Aussie’s tough day out
An injured Nick Kyrgios did it tough in his round of 16 clash against Croatian Borna Coric, bowing out in straight sets but not without some patented theatrics.
The Aussie laboured through what seemed to be a significant knee injury, dropping the first set 6-3 and looking to score solely off his serve.
“I can’t serve without pain … when I land it feels unstable,” Kyrgios was be heard telling the trainer after the first set.
“I’ll probably just play one more game. I’m serving at like 170 (km/h)…
